Output 66400a00a782f6fc5952d9da0d7c9ed0b3821716d0ef057c0ba6e41bd4c99af7:0

value
86370000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 29ba312cef6ef9581e5feec5ec011f516a22fdf5 OP_EQUALVERIFY OP_CHECKSIG
address
14odkiffkj4CGSPnVk2HnACVdn8UDD4zCx
transaction
66400a00a782f6fc5952d9da0d7c9ed0b3821716d0ef057c0ba6e41bd4c99af7
confirmations
550115
spent
true